Heads of the Living Dead : Medusa

Regular price $12.00
What if Medusa was somehow able to reattach her head after Perseus had severed it? Well, if she was able to somehow get it back on, the Gods would be none too happy...she must now be a Zombie Horror!

  • All prints are 8.5X11 in size and printed on mid gloss card stock.
  • All prints are shipped flat in a sturdy envelope, with a stiff backing to prevent bending during shipment.

You may also like